Doha Film Institute recruits Farhadi as Qumra Master

MNA Oscar-winning Iranian directorAsghar Farhadiis among the first recruited masters for theDoha Film Institutes 2017Qumraevent which seeks to provide mentorship for filmmakers around the world.


Highly-acclaimed Iranian filmmaker Asghar Farhadi, known for his Oscar-winning film A Separation and Cannes award-winner dramaThe Salesman, as well as French directorBruno Dumont, and Cambodian-born documentary filmmakerRithy Panh are the first recruited masters for theDoha Film Institutes 2017Qumraevent, according to Variety.

Each Qumra Master will participate in a series of masterclasses, workshops and one-on-one sessions with directors of participating DFI-backed projects and industry professionals from around the world, and also screen one of their pics for Doha audiences.

Two more Qumra Masters will be announced during the Berlin Film Festival.

Qumra has been active since 2014 and the past masters include Mexican multihyphenate Gael Garcia Bernal; Romanian director Cristian Mungiu;US producer and director James Schamus; Russian director Aleksandr Sokurov; Bosnian director Danis Tanovic; and Japanese director Naomi Kawase.

The third edition of Qumra is set to take place in Doha March 3-8, 2017.
